The (also referred to as "Link to PSA Interface USB") is a critical utility tool used to manage the firmware and hardware configuration of the Lexia 3 / PP2000 / XS Evolution diagnostic interfaces. It is primarily used to identify device revisions, update or roll back firmware, and toggle between diagnostic modes like DiagBox or wiTECH . 1. Key Functions
Usually "Full Chip" versions. These are recommended for modern Peugeot/Citroën models and work best with the latest DiagBox versions.
The "440" status is most stable on interfaces (those with the 921815C serial and high-quality optocouplers). "Lite" versions can sometimes be flashed to 440, but they may still experience communication errors with specific ECUs like airbags or power steering. When a multiplexer falls into a loop showing an init ko status or struggles to read vehicle modules beyond basic VIN detection, this tool acts as a factory reset mechanism. It rewires the inner flash app block to establish cleaner serial communication.
If the interface connects but systematically drops vehicle communication with newer cars or completely misses essential controllers like the Engine Control Unit (ECU), your multiplexer is likely an inferior "Lite" clone lacking optocouplers and filtering capacitors. Reflashing firmware via the utility software cannot fix underlying, physically missing board components.
